Listening to sounds played back on
a Bluetooth device from the speakers
1
Connect a Bluetooth USB adaptor.
• Refer to page 47.
2
Press [Bluetooth 6].
3
Start playback on the Bluetooth
device.
NOTE
• To turn off the signals from the Bluetooth device,
refer to page 50.
Operating the Bluetooth device
using the remote control
When the Bluetooth device is compatible with the
AVRCP profile, you can operate the Bluetooth
device using the remote control of this system.
Remote control
button
[Bluetooth 6]
7
4/¢
* To pause playback, depending on the Bluetooth
device, press [Bluetooth 6] once or hold it
down for one or more seconds. To return to nor-
mal playback, press the same button again.
NOTE
• Some Bluetooth devices may not be controlled
by the remote control of this system.
Usage
Starts and pauses
playback. *
Stops playback.
Selects a track.
For the locations of the remote
control buttons, refer to page 46.
Listening to sounds played
back on the main unit from
Bluetooth devices
Pairing this system and a Bluetooth
device
1
Connect a Bluetooth USB adaptor.
• Refer to page 47.
2
Operate the desired Bluetooth
device (headphone) so that this
system can discover it.
• For details on the setting, refer to the opera-
tion manual for the Bluetooth device.
3
Press [DVD/CD 6], [USB1 6],
[USB2 6] or [TUNER/AUDIO IN]
to select a source other than "BT"
(Bluetooth) in the display window.
4
Hold down [Bluetooth 6] for 2 or
more seconds.
• The built-in transmitter of the main unit is
activated.
• The "Bluetooth" indicator starts flashing.
5
Press [Bluetooth SETTING] repeat-
edly while holding down [SHIFT] to
select "SRCH DV" in the display
window.
6
Press [ENTER/SET].
• The main unit starts searching for Bluetooth
devices.
• The name of the Bluetooth device discov-
ered first appears in the display window.
